M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


4 participantes

    Verificação de campos antes de salvar novo registro

    avatar
    rionide
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 38
    Registrado : 01/03/2014

    Verificação de campos antes de salvar novo registro Empty Verificação de campos antes de salvar novo registro

    Mensagem  rionide 21/9/2022, 20:38

    Boa tarde, Pessoal!
    Estou com projeto em andamento, tenho um Frm_Cad_Equipamentos com Listbox onde eu queria dar dois clicks em um arquivo na Listbox e jogar ele para os campos acima para edição, estou usando um código pegado aqui no fórum que já uso em outro Frm_Emprestimo e funciona perfeitamente, mais no Frm_Cad_Equipamentos da erro, o código é:

    Pessoal essa parte do Duplo click eu consegui resolver vendo uma outra postagem aqui mesmo no forum:
    Private Sub ListBox_Equip_DblClick(Cancel As Integer)
    Me.Filter = "[Npatri] = " & Me.ListBox_Equip.Column(0) & ""
    Me.FilterOn = True
    Me.Requery
    End Sub

    Esse código acima ficou assim agora:
    Private Sub ListBox_Equip_DblClick(Cancel As Integer)
    Me.Filter = "[Npatri] = '" & Me.ListBox_Equip.Column(0) & "'"
    Me.FilterOn = True
    Me.Requery
    End Sub

    Agora preciso de filtro para filtrar o campo “NPatri” do SubFrm_DetalheEmprestimo esse campo “NPatri” é a chave primaria da Tbl_PRINCIPAL_CAD_EQUIPAMENTOS.

    Tambem preciso de um código para verificar se o número de patrimônio do equipamento, representado pelo campo “NPatri” no SubFrm_DetalheEmprestimo não aceite um NPatri que esteja com um empréstimo não finalizado.
    Segue meu Projeto e prints das telhas que preciso.
    Link para baixar meu projeto: https://drive.google.com/drive/folders/1Myyd6mMeirsq1pdwM6YOCuqL9lASM-pF?usp=sharingVerificação de campos antes de salvar novo registro Dois_c10
    Verificação de campos antes de salvar novo registro Pesqui10
    Anexos
    Verificação de campos antes de salvar novo registro AttachmentBANCO_DADOS_INFO_CONSTRUCAO.zip
    Meu Banco de dados em construção
    Você não tem permissão para fazer download dos arquivos anexados.
    (1.4 Mb) Baixado 35 vez(es)

    icruznina gosta desta mensagem

    avatar
    Tiago123
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 14
    Registrado : 31/05/2012

    Verificação de campos antes de salvar novo registro Empty Re: Verificação de campos antes de salvar novo registro

    Mensagem  Tiago123 26/9/2022, 13:18

    Bom dia

    Voce esta tentado filtrar um campo tipo texto, coloque aspas no criterio, exemplo abaixo


       Filtro = "[Npatri] = '" & Me.ListBox_Equip.Column(0) & "'"
       Me.Form.Filter = Filtro
       Me.Form.FilterOn = True
       Me.Requery
    avatar
    rionide
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 38
    Registrado : 01/03/2014

    Verificação de campos antes de salvar novo registro Empty Re: Verificação de campos antes de salvar novo registro

    Mensagem  rionide 26/9/2022, 14:25

    Sim Tiago123
    Era isso mesmo, essa parte eu já resolvi.
    Agora estou precisando fazer uma forma de filtrar no Frm_Emprestimo no campo: Pesquisa pelo NPatri do SubFormulario. esse campo NPatri do subformulario não esta na minha listbox
    crysostomo
    crysostomo
    Maximo VIP
    Maximo V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2676
    Registrado : 23/01/2018

    Verificação de campos antes de salvar novo registro Empty Re: Verificação de campos antes de salvar novo registro

    Mensagem  crysostomo 26/9/2022, 22:26

    Boa noite Srs.
    rionide, confusão nas tabela amigo.
    O seu Npatri está na tabela principal cas de equipamentos coloque ele na listBox para puxar ao digitar pelo campo mestre e campo filho ou refaça o que o Tiago123 sugeriu.
    Na verde seria melhor voce relacionar as tabelas de modo nó. 1-1 e 1-∞

    at...


    .................................................................................
    Obs.: Coloque somente as partes defeituosas para que possamos encontrar e entender  o problema mais rápido para lhe ajudar. Disponho.
    Uma mão ajuda a outra.
    Feliz aquele que transfere o que sabe e aprende o que ensina.
    avatar
    rionide
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 38
    Registrado : 01/03/2014

    Verificação de campos antes de salvar novo registro Empty Verificação em dois campos antes de salvar registro

    Mensagem  rionide 27/9/2022, 13:25

    Bom dia, Pessoal!
    Vocês são show, com as dicas de vocês resolvi as questões de dar dois click na linha Listbox e jogar o registro selecionado para o formulário de edição.
    E tambem resolvi, o filtro no SubFomulario pelo NPatri, segue print da telas como fiz para resolver.

    Ainda estou precisando de uma ajuda de vocês, preciso na hora de cadastrar um novo empréstimo, fazer um verificação nos registros anteriores se o Nº Patri tem algum registro de empréstimo com Status "Aberto" caso tenha não aceitar salvar o novo registro.
    Verificação de campos antes de salvar novo registro Frm_em10
    Verificação de campos antes de salvar novo registro Listbo10
    Verificação de campos antes de salvar novo registro Pesqui11
    Anexos
    Verificação de campos antes de salvar novo registro AttachmentBANCO_DADOS_FeitoAuteracao.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(1.4 Mb) Baixado 21 vez(es)
    crysostomo
    crysostomo
    Maximo VIP
    Maximo V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2676
    Registrado : 23/01/2018

    Verificação de campos antes de salvar novo registro Empty Re: Verificação de campos antes de salvar novo registro

    Mensagem  crysostomo 27/9/2022, 15:29



    .................................................................................
    Obs.: Coloque somente as partes defeituosas para que possamos encontrar e entender  o problema mais rápido para lhe ajudar. Disponho.
    Uma mão ajuda a outra.
    Feliz aquele que transfere o que sabe e aprende o que ensina.
    Alexandre Fim
    Alexandre Fim
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3213
    Registrado : 13/12/2016

    Verificação de campos antes de salvar novo registro Empty Re: Verificação de campos antes de salvar novo registro

    Mensagem  Alexandre Fim 27/9/2022, 15:42

    Rionide bom dia,

    Estou analisando o sistema e verifiquei no cadastro de emprestimos (Frm_Emprestimo) que é possível incluir 1 ou mais equipamentos , que ficam armazenados na tabela "Tbl_DetalheEmprestimos", porém, o STATUS encontra-se equivocadamente na tabela "Tbl_Emprestimo", mas deve estar na "Tbl_DetalheEmprestimos", visto que se o usuário incluir mais de 1 equipamento no cadastro, e este equipamento tiver sido devolvido em algum momento, na consulta que foi montada para carregar a listbox vai constar como "Aberto", pelo fato desta informação estar na "Tbl_Emprestimo".

    Existem 2 situações:
    - controlar o status por emprestimo
    - controlar o status por equipamento

    Voce tmb pode manter os 2 status.
    Ex: Emprestimo de 3 equipamentos, porém, 2 foram devolvidos e o status do emprestimo (Frm_Emprestimo) ficaria em Aberto.
    Quando o 3º equipamento for devolvido, o status do emprestimo mudaria automaticamente para "finalizado"

    Na sua opinião, esse é o raciocínio correto?


    Até mais

    Att,

    Alexandre Fim


    .................................................................................
    Arrow  Marcar tópico como Resolvido: clique aqui
    Arrow  Postar anexos no fórum: clique aqui

    Verificação de campos antes de salvar novo registro Setinf11
    Sistemas e Tecnologia Ltda

    crysostomo gosta desta mensagem


    Conteúdo patrocinado


    Verificação de campos antes de salvar novo registro Empty Re: Verificação de campos antes de salvar novo registro

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 21/4/2024, 21:19